Visualizzazione dei risultati da 1 a 4 su 4

Discussione: Problemi invio mail

  1. #1

    Problemi invio mail

    Buon giorno, non riesco a capire come mai alcuni utenti ricevono la mail dal sito altri no.
    Utilizzo lo script di seguito per inviarle.
    Mi dite cortesemente dove e se c'è l'errore?
    codice:
    if (strlen($_SESSION['SessMailUserEsterno']) > 0) {
    				$destinatari  = $txtMail ;
    				$oggetto = "Segnalazione";
    				$messaggio = '<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">'
    							.'<html>'
    							.'	<head>'
    							.'		<title>Conferma ricezione della Vostra Registrazione del '.date("Y-m-d G:i:s").' al sito</title>'
    							.'		<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">'
    							.'	</head>'
    							.'	<body>';
    
    							if($Update != "" || $Insert!=""){
    								if($Update=="1"){
    									$messaggio .='
    
    La Vostra Registrazione del '.date("Y-m-d G:i:s").' è stata aggiornata.</p>';
    								}
    								else{
    									$messaggio .='		
    
    La Vostra Registrazione del '.date("Y-m-d G:i:s").' è andata a buon fine.</p>';
    								}
    								$messaggio .=	 '
    
    
    														Per confermare la registrazione deve cliccare qui
    															Conferma registrazione.
    												  </p>';
    							}
    							else{
    								$messaggio .='
    
    La Vostra Registrazione del '.date("Y-m-d G:i:s").' è stata cancellata.</p>';
    							}
    
    				$messaggio .='
    
    Un cordiale saluto.</p>.'
    							.'	</body>'
    							.'</html>'
    							.'';
    
    				/* Per inviare email in formato HTML, si deve impostare l'intestazione Content-type. */
    				$intestazioni = "";
    				$intestazioni .= "MIME-Version: 1.0\r\n";
    				$intestazioni .= "Content-type: text/html; charset=iso-8859-1\r\n";
    				$intestazioni .= "From: Mio Sito<webdesigner@miosito.it>\r\n";
    
    				/* ed infine l'invio */
    				if(isset($_SESSION['verificaInvioMail'])){
    					if(@mail($destinatari, $oggetto, $messaggio, $intestazioni)) {
    						$_SESSION['verificaInvioMail'] = "1";
    						if($Update == "1"){
    							echo "DATI AGGIORNATI CON SUCCESSO - EMAIL INOLTRATA CON SUCCESSO";
    						}
    						elseif($Insert == "1"){
    							echo "	LE ABBIAMO INVIATO UNA MAIL NELLA QUALE TROVER&Aacute; UN LINK PER CONFERMARE LA REGISTRAZIONE!
    									EMAIL INOLTRATA CON SUCCESSO.";
    						}
    						else{
    							echo "UTENTE CANCELLATO CON SUCCESSO - EMAIL INOLTRATA CON SUCCESSO";
    						}
    					}
    					else{
    						echo "Problemi nell'invio della mail di conferma Registrazione!
    								Controlla eventualmente nella tua casella di posta se ti è arrivata la nostra mail per coinfermare la registrazione.";
    					}
    				}
    				else{
    					echo "OPERAZIONE GI&Agrave; ESEGUITA ED EMAIL GI&Agrave; INOLTRATA";
    					$_SESSION['verificaInvioMail'] = "";
    				}
    
    				include('opzioni/countdown/countdown.htm');
    				header("Refresh: 15; URL=LogOut.php");
    			}
    		}
    		echo "</div>";
    Grazie mille....

  2. #2
    In che senso "altri no"?

    Spam, quarantena o altro?
    Realizzazione Software, Siti Web ed E-commerce. Consulenza Software ed esperti open source ...
    Scopri i nostri servizi...

  3. #3
    sicuramente la trovano sulla cartella spam.

    io questo problema l'avevo con le mail di xx@alice.it
    annunci gratuiti
    www.disuso.com

    annunci
    www.abcannunci.it

  4. #4
    Pare che la valorizzazione del reply-to nell'header, in alcuni casi sia determinante. Poi se continua ad essere spam c'é poco da fare
    PHP LEARN - Guide, tutorial e articoli sempre aggiornati
    NUOVO: standardLib; il potente framework PHP é ora disponibile
    *******************************************
    Scarica oggi la tua copia di MtxEventManager

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.